Fairwinds Technologies and Fairlead Form Strategic Alliance to Deliver Multi-Domain Adaptive Autonomy for the U.S. Navy, Marine Corps, and Space Force
ANNAPOLIS, Md., October 14, 2025 – Fairwinds Technologies and Fairlead have announced a strategic partnership to develop and deploy advanced Multi-Domain Adaptive Autonomy (MDA²) solutions in support of the U.S. Department of War.
This alliance combines Fairlead’s expertise in maritime systems engineering, naval integration, and defense manufacturing across the submarine, unmanned surface vessel, and aircraft carrier industrial base with Fairwinds Technologies’ leadership in defense communication networks, autonomous systems, spectrum warfare, cybersecurity, and AI-enabled platforms. Together, the companies are delivering mission-ready capabilities that support joint, distributed operations and enable decision dominance across air, sea, land, and space.
Jim Sprungle, Fairwinds Technologies CEO, states “Our combined efforts are focused on creating adaptive, multi-domain technologies that deliver a decisive advantage in contested environments—at sea, in the air, on the ground, and beyond the atmosphere.”
“This partnership represents a powerful fusion of maritime innovation and advanced autonomy,” said Fred Pasquine, President and CEO of Fairlead. “By integrating our strengths, we are positioned to accelerate delivery of critical capabilities to the warfighter.”
Key Areas of Focus
● Non-Terrestrial Network (NTN) tactical satellite communications for high-throughput, low-latency data, secure voice, and real-time video at the tactical edge, enabling resilient, interoperable connectivity in dynamic and denied environments
● Autonomous maritime, drone, and space systems for distributed MDA² operations to augment maritime domain awareness and space domain awareness
● AI data center and quantum-edge mission modules focused on cyber defense, large-scale force optimization, and unmanned systems integration frameworks for Unmanned Aircraft Systems (UAS) and Counter-Unmanned Aircraft Systems (C-UAS) operations
● Containerized AI Positioning, Navigation, and Timing (PNT) and spectrum dominance solutions with Zero Trust security, precision navigation, and timing for secure, scalable, and resilient edge computing in contested and distributed environments
● Forward-deployed containerized MIL-SPEC mission modules for rapidly reconfigurable capabilities across shipboard, shore-based, and expeditionary platforms
The partnership also supports the development of AI solutions aligned with national defense priorities, including initiatives framed under the U.S. Department of War legacy doctrine. These capabilities are designed to enhance strategic foresight, automate command functions, and optimize multi-domain force deployments under high-threat conditions.
Space-based mobile broadband for defense delivers secure, high-speed communications to mobile and disaggregated units across the globe, supporting bandwidth-intensive applications, including Intelligence, Surveillance, and Reconnaissance (ISR) streaming and autonomous swarm operations.
Containerized AI data center mission modules equipped with Zero Trust security architectures provide secure, scalable, and resilient edge computing capabilities that enable warfighters to process, analyze, and act on data rapidly, while protecting against cyber threats in contested environments. MIL-SPEC mission modules expand mission flexibility by enabling plug-and-play configurations in shipboard, expeditionary, or forward-deployed operations.
Aligned with key Department of War initiatives, such as Joint All-Domain Command and Control (JADC2), this partnership reflects a shared commitment to delivering resilient, distributed, and AI-enabled capabilities across all warfighting domains. Fairlead and Fairwinds Technologies are accelerating the delivery of advanced technologies that enhance readiness, agility, and lethality for the modern warfighter.

About Fairwinds Technologies
Fairwinds Technologies designs and integrates communications, networking, and IT solutions to serve defense and civilian agencies around the world. Fairwinds strives to meet critical needs by combining innovative products with specialized services—no matter the mission. Fairwinds is a small business founded in 2016. About Fairlead Integrated
Fairlead Integrated builds integrated electrical and control systems, large-scale mechanical fabrications and structures, precision machined metal components/subsystems and advanced mobile containerized products. Today, Fairlead’s products are part of mission-critical systems in the U.S. Navy’s Nimitz and Ford-class aircraft carriers, Virginia-class submarines, the Littoral Combat Ship and many classes of support and auxiliary ships of the Military Sealift Command, the Maritime Administration and the U.S. Coast Guard. Additionally, Fairlead provides repair and maintenance services to small boats and craft through its Fairlead Boatworks division in Newport News, VA. Fairlead Integrated is headquartered in Portsmouth, VA with facilities in Portsmouth, Chesapeake, Virginia Beach, and Newport News.
